elemetnUI表格分别给列表每一个按钮加loading

// 获取列表数据的时候——添加按钮loading
this.list = this.list.map((item) => {
    this.$set(item, "dataLoading", false);
    return item;
});

// 触发点击事件改变loading
this.$set(row, "dataLoading", true);

//按钮的loading
<el-button :loading="row.dataLoading"></el-button>

 

注:有时候 loading[row.id] 也有可能会生效,但是上述方法肯定会生效

 

posted @ 2021-05-07 16:11  樛了个elevens  阅读(227)  评论(0编辑  收藏  举报